Transaction 61537495d8f50296d4dde37f4209438daad209fecd0469e2418dce602186ba2d
1 Input
1 Output
-
61537495d8f50296d4dde37f4209438daad209fecd0469e2418dce602186ba2d:0
- value
- 17466460
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c16fc341cc122afe31682d8ad9ede951c07ea3ad O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JdoJS8uJRhJvzPnhfWbveRt5awQCPZwnc